PIETRYKOWSKI, J.

{¶ 1} This accelerated appeal is before the court following the October 18, 2013 judgment of the Lucas County Court of Common Pleas which denied appellant, Rene Mays, individually, and on behalf of the estate of Galon Howard's motion for relief from judgment pursuant to Civ.R. 60(B).

{¶ 2} Appellant's assignment of error provides:

The trial court abused its discretion in denying inter alia Appellant's Rule 60(B) motions to vacate judgment entries of October 18, 2013, and October 22, 2013, under the facts and circumstances of this case.

{¶ 3} In a related appeal recently decided in this court, we affirmed the trial court's dismissal of appellant's claims. See Mays v. Toledo Hosp., 6th Dist. Lucas No. L-13-1233, 2014-Ohio-1991. Based upon our decision in that appeal and rejecting appellant's arguments relating to the multiple post-dismissal motions filed in this action, we affirm the October 18, 2013 judgment of the trial court. Accordingly, appellant's assignment of error is not well-taken.

{¶ 4} On consideration whereof, we find that appellant was not prevented or prejudiced from having a fair proceeding and the judgment of the Lucas County Court of Common Pleas is affirmed. Pursuant to App.R. 24, appellant is ordered to pay the costs of this appeal.

Judgment affirmed.
